WebSep 19, 2024 · Uveitis is an inflammation of the uvea, the middle layer of the eye's surface. The uvea includes the iris, which makes up the colored area at the front of the eye. When uveitis is localized at the front of the eye, it's called iritis (or anterior uveitis). WebJul 3, 2024 · Infections: Tuberculosis, lung infections or syphilis among other bacterial and viral infections could cause the iris to swell and become inflamed. Injury: Any injury caused to the eye by external factors such as chemicals or fire could also cause iritis. Webinfections such as shingles, tuberculosis, syphilis or HIV can also be associated with anterior uveitis (iritis). What are the symptoms of acute anterior uveitis (iritis)? You may have an aching and painful red eye, made worse in bright light or when you try to read. Symptoms of anterior uveitis can develop quickly
